How We Tested These Sites for Real Cashback Value
We deposited real money at each casino, played through a mix of slots and live dealer games, and tracked exactly how much cashback we received. Our testing team focused on three metrics: the percentage of losses returned, the maximum cashback cap, and the wagering requirements attached to the cashback itself. A 10% cashback offer sounds generous, but if the cap is £20 and you need to wager the cashback 40x before withdrawal, the value drops significantly.
We also checked whether cashback is paid automatically or requires manual opt-in. Some sites, like PlayOJO, credit cashback directly to your balance without any fuss. Others require you to claim it within a specific window, which is easy to miss if you’re not checking your account daily. What to Watch Out for in the Small Print
Not all cashback is created equal. Some operators cap the amount you can receive per week at a paltry £10, while others offer up to £100. The devil is always in the wagering requirements. A cashback credit that requires 35x wagering before withdrawal is essentially a reload bonus in disguise. We prefer offers where the cashback is credited as real cash with zero wagering, which is exactly what Sky Vegas and PlayOJO provide. These are the benchmark of cashback promotions in our opinion.
Another trap is the time limit. Some casinos require you to claim your cashback within 24 hours of the calculation period, or it expires. That’s a bit tight if you only check your account once a week. Always read the specific T&C clause for each promotion. Common Misconceptions About Cashback Offers
Does cashback count toward my overall wagering requirements?
No, cashback is separate from welcome bonus wagering. If you have an active welcome bonus with a 35x wagering requirement, cashback credits don’t help you clear that requirement. They’re an independent benefit that sits alongside your main bonus. Some players mistakenly think cashback can be used to meet wagering targets, but that’s not how the maths works.
Can I withdraw cashback immediately without playing?
It depends on the operator. At PlayOJO and Sky Vegas, cashback is credited as real cash with zero wagering, so you can withdraw it straight away. At 32Red and William Hill, the cashback is subject to a 10x wagering requirement on winnings, meaning you need to play through the cashback amount before requesting a withdrawal. Always check the specific terms for each promotion before assuming it’s free money.
Is cashback better than a standard deposit bonus?
For casual players who deposit small amounts, cashback is often more valuable because it doesn’t require a large initial stake. A 100% deposit bonus up to £100 is great if you plan to deposit £100, but if you only deposit £10, the bonus is tiny. Cashback, on the other hand, scales with your losses. If you lose £50 over a week, a 10% cashback offer gives you £5 back regardless of your deposit size. That’s a fairer deal for low-stakes players.
